Squeaky-Clean, Renovated Farmhouse + 4 acres in Ulster County, $200,000
Kandy Harris | January 26, 2016It looks brand-new, but this 1500 sq. ft. farmhouse was actually built in 1890 and received a big face-lift within the past five years. These days, it’s sporting stainless steel appliances in the kitchen, polished wood floors, toasty livingroom woodstove, and a stackable washer/dryer. But that doesn’t mean some of the old-fashioned farmhouse details have been left by the wayside, as evidenced by the handmade support and ceiling beams.
Just about every aspect of the siding, mechanicals, and plumbing have been upgraded, so it is kind of like moving into a new house. And, if you think you can’t find a 3 bedroom home on lots of land (4 acres) in Ulster County close to both New Paltz and Orange County (NYC is less than 2 hours away) for $200,000, allow this property to serve as a very pleasant surprise.
